Killing of a 19-year-old student by an unidentified vehicle while distributing newspapers on his cycle in Rohini last Saturday has once again highlighted the dangers cyclists face on city roads. Last year, there was a 77% increase in cyclist fatalities in the capital compared to the previous year. According to Delhi Police, there were 53 fatal accidents in 2024, the same number of lives lost....
